While not under the official aegis of the Wine & Food Festival, Friday night's peripheral event at the Hotel Victor sure created a lot of buzz. Held on the rooftop pool deck, across Ocean Drive from the Grand Tasting Village, the late-night SoBe Soundcheck offered a chance for many of the Food Network chefs and personalities "to casually have fun and kick back with friends," as host Rachael Ray, whose hubby fronts featured performers The Cringe, put it.
Event planner Dorota Kenar of Terlato Wines International searched tirelessly for a venue that could meet hosts' and attendees' needs before deciding on the Victor.
"We wanted this event to be very approachable," said Kenar, using a word that the Seven Daughters brand also uses to describe its unique wines, made with a blend of seven grapes. "The pairing of the Victor's intimate rooftop with personable and affable Rachael Ray represented the Seven Daughters brand well."More than 350 guests mixed and mingled with Ray's Food Network co-stars throughout the night, including Bobby Flay and Guy Fieri, as well as Miami local Gloria Estefan. The Cringe rocked the stage with their original upbeat tracks, as guests sampled late-night desserts compliments of the hotel's on-site eatery, Vix Restaurant.
